Well ATM actually stands for asynchronous transfer mode and can be described as a standard cell based switching method which specifically makes the use of asynchronous time division multiplexing which allows transforming specific data into definite sized cells or cell relay and offers specific data link layer support which especially run on OSI Layer 1 physical links. Most often individuals confuse it with packet switched networks such as the Internet Protocol or Ethernet where different sized tiny packets are utilized for data transfer.
ATM or asynchronous transfer mode generally possesses elements of two types of networking. This suggests that it can be employed in each of circuit switched in addition to packet switched networking. This permits it to act as the ideal means of a wide variety of data transfer. It is additionally very suitable for real time media transport. The design which is especially employed in this specific method of data transfer is primarily connection oriented, thus readily joining the two end points with virtual circuit even before the data beginning to transfer.
Asynchronous transfer mode technology will easily be used for both LAN and WAN connections. ATM additionally has several other unique features which are mentioned in brief as follows:
Asynchronous transfer mode easily provides excellent transmission speeds for both LAN and WAN links by basically enabling distributed applications of substantial complexity that formerly could only be utilized in a LAN link but was unsuccessful on WAN systems.
ATM utilizes the fundamental techniques to switch between individual integrated switching systems. As a result, it is especially appropriate for those distributed software that usually generate constant bit rate or CBR traffic. This is also applicable to variable bit rate or VBR.
